A spellbinding novel of psychological suspense. Speculations on the possibility of reincarnation are merely of academic interest to Dr. Frederic Pleier, even when he discovers the treatise of a seventeenth-century German physician whose name he shares and whose work is eerily similar. This seems no more than bizarre coincidence until a suicidal young patient whom Pleier is treating claims to recognize the doctor from another place and time; and when the patient mysteriously disappears from the clinic to which he has been confined, Dr. Pleier's guilt and painful sense of responsibility trigger an agonizing series of nightmare journeys back to the horror and carnage of a Germany ravaged by the Thirty Years' War...the dark and bloody world of Fridericus Pleiert.
